Forget Peace Square. the First Escalator in the Czech Republic Was Made of Wood and Looked Like It Came From Another World.

The first escalator in the Czech lands was wooden and started operating in Prague's Letná 100 years ago, on March 21, 1926. It was a covered moving staircase with wooden steps on the route of the canceled funicular. The moving staircase operated until 1935, and the escalator also played a role in a film: the scenes on the moving staircase in the film Men in the Offside were filmed right here.
